Abstract
We propose a coarse estimation scheme of carrier frequency offset in orthogonal frequency division multiplexing (OFDM) systems. The proposed method uses the correlation which is put between the subcarriers of the training symbols to estimate the integer part of the relative frequency offset. The algorithm can estimate a relatively wide range of carrier frequency offset in spite of its much lower computational complexity compared to the conventional cross-correlation methods. Simulation results show that the missing rate of the coarse estimator is sufficiently low and the variance of the final estimates approaches the Cramer-Rao lower bound at reasonable range of signal-to-noise ratios (SNRs).
